Twilight Sessions: Schools (Health Promotion and Nutrition) (Scotland) Act 2007The Schools (Health Promotion and Nutrition) (Scotland) Act 2007 (the Act) has implications for the whole school community. It also impacts on Fife’s Health promoting Schools Framework which is currently being reviewed to bring it in line with the Curriculum for Excellence Health & Wellbeing Experiences and Outcomes.

With all these changes and developments it is an ideal time to bring together School Health Co-ordinators, Hungry for Success/Hospitality Co-ordinators and School Health Staff so that we might develop a clearer and shared understanding of the implications.
